An Advanced Certificate in Technology Integration for Diverse Learners equips educators with the skills to effectively leverage technology in inclusive classrooms. This program focuses on pedagogical approaches that cater to varied learning styles and needs, making technology a powerful tool for differentiation and accessibility.
Learning outcomes include mastering assistive technologies, designing engaging digital learning experiences, and implementing Universal Design for Learning (UDL) principles within technology-rich environments. Graduates will be proficient in utilizing various software and hardware to support diverse learners, including students with disabilities and those from diverse cultural backgrounds.
The duration of the program is typically flexible, often ranging from several months to a year, depending on the institution and the specific course structure. It's designed to fit the schedules of working professionals and offers online or blended learning options for convenience. Self-paced modules and instructor support are commonly available.
